Can Bed Bugs Stay In The Walls . In the february issue of scientific american entomologist kenneth haynes of the university of kentucky explains how, after a lengthy absence, bed bugs are staging a comeback. Scientists debate this point, but evidence suggests that at normal room temperature, about 23 degrees celsius, bedbugs can only survive two to three months without a blood meal.
